The University of Rochester, located in Rochester, New York, is a renowned healthcare facility that offers top-notch healthcare amenities to its community. With the ZIP Code 14623, the university's healthcare services are easily accessible to both residents and potential movers looking for quality healthcare options in the area.
Rochester, New York has a rich history dating back to the early 19th century when it was known as the "Flour City" due to its thriving flour mills. Today, it is a vibrant city known for its culture, innovation, and excellent healthcare facilities. The University of Rochester has been a pivotal part of the city's growth and development, particularly in the healthcare sector.
The university's medical center is a hub for cutting-edge medical research and patient care. It offers a wide range of specialty services including cardiology, oncology, neurology, and orthopedics, making it a comprehensive healthcare destination for individuals with diverse medical needs.
